Chien-Shiung Wu Proves Parity Violation

Physicist Chien-Shiung Wu announced experimental proof that nature violates 'conservation of parity,' overturning a basic assumption of physics; her Columbia colleagues Lee and Yang won the Nobel, but Wu-later the first woman to lead the American Physical Society-did not. Fred Korematsu Awarded the Presidential Medal of Freedom

On January 15, 1998, President Clinton awarded Fred Korematsu the Presidential Medal of Freedom — the nation's highest civilian honor — for his lifelong stand against the WWII incarceration of Japanese Americans, which he had challenged all the way to the Supreme Court in 1944.
